Output 340b86670837bc78dd47700e8e876dee511a044d5e7439e84363f942a6d1cccb:25

value
51947900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c00cd9f623ebb3a604709ea62f7543365212b716 OP_EQUAL
address
MRQdNCApnwQyHLJV9FX56QdGHgPHfk1K1R
transaction
340b86670837bc78dd47700e8e876dee511a044d5e7439e84363f942a6d1cccb
spent
true